OPINION - Is The Corrupt Greek Media Suddenly Falling in Love With Alexis?

The participation of main opposition Alexis Tsipras in an international forum in Como a few days ago obviously disappointed some of his comrades who we all know preferred that he appeared in the demonstrations that were taking place in the northern city of Thessaloniki where Prime Minister Antonis Samaras gave a speech about the nation's economy, but for those who are still in touch with reality, it was an obvious initiative for a party and leader vying for power. This was the theme of an article that appeared in To Vima at the weekend and which obviously leaves us with the impression that the publishers (some of Greece's most influential oligarchs) are turning their backs on the coalition government and sucking up to Alexis. (For a possible run as prime minister?)

The article, which clearly speaks to voters of the center, says that if the left wants to claim a significant role in Greek political life then it must expand its horizons and decide on whether or not Greece is an integral part of Europe. And what is worse, it condemns some party members for not realising this, but hails Alexis who it said has a better understanding of things.

Huh?

The guy spoke at the “Forum of Como”, at the posh Villa d’Este and some of the participants at this event included names such as Barroso, Monti, Almunia Asmousen, Trichet, etc. (in other words, representatives of the  European Neoliberal \Establishment).

The forum is held every autumn in the famous Villa d’Este resort which in 2009 was declared by  Forbes magazine as being the best hotel in the world! And Tsipras represented Greece among other heavy names such as the former Prime Minister of Italy Enrico Letta and Mario Monti, the former European Commission President Jose Manuel Barroso, the banker Jean Claude Trichet, the German Minister Jörg Asmussen, and Commissioners Joaquín Almunia and Michel Barnier.
